Как функционируют базы данных и серверы

Как функционируют базы данных и серверы

Нынешние виртуальные системы работают благодаря сотрудничеству двух главных компонентов. Серверы обрабатывают требования клиентов и осуществляют операции. Хранилища данных сохраняют данные в организованном формате. Постижение принципов функционирования помогает освоить в процессах функционирования 1win casino электронных сервисов и приложений.

Почему за каждым ресурсом и программой стоит незаметная инфраструктура

Юзеры видят только интерфейс программы или веб-страницы. За визуальной оболочкой находится многоуровневая техническая организация. Серверное техника располагается в дата-центрах и обеспечивает постоянную работу сервиса. Хранилища хранения данных хранят миллионы сведений о клиентах, транзакциях и содержимом.

Инфраструктура исполняет критично существенные функции. Она обслуживает входящие требования от тысяч клиентов синхронно. Части системы верифицируют полномочия входа и защищают секретную сведения. 1вин организует сотрудничество между различными модулями приложения. Без надежной инженерной фундамента нельзя разработать стабильный виртуальный сервис.

Что такое сервер и зачем он требуется цифровому решению

Сервер является собой компьютер с значительной производительностью, который выполняет запросы клиентских аппаратов. Системное софт контролирует доступом к мощностям и делит нагрузку. 1вин отвечает за алгоритмы деятельности сервиса и связь с хранилищами информации. Без серверной компонента недостижима деятельность современных онлайн-служб.

Как база данных содержит сведения и помогает моментально ее находить

База данных упорядочивает информацию в таблицы, файлы или схемы. Структурированное хранение обеспечивает быстро доставать необходимые данные. 1win casino применяет особые алгоритмы для ускорения доступа к сведениям.

Эффективность работы обеспечивается различными механизмами:

  • Индексы формируют ссылки на регулярно требуемые сведения
  • Кэширование хранит популярные обращения в кэше
  • Партиционирование дробит объёмные таблицы части фрагменты
  • Репликация копирует сведения на несколько серверов

Корректная структура системы сокращает время реакции и повышает производительность приложения.

Что случается, когда юзер загружает ресурс или сервис

Клиентское оборудование отправляет запрос на сервер через интернет. Запрос включает информацию о требуемой странице или операции. Машина изучает запрос и выявляет необходимые сведения для реакции.

Архитектура обращается к хранилищу для получения требуемых записей. 1win casino выполняет поиск по определённым условиям и выдаёт результаты. Машина выполняет сведения и создаёт HTML-документ или JSON-ответ. Сформированный итог доставляется на оборудование юзера. Браузер или сервис отображает данные на дисплее. Весь цикл занимает доли секунды при правильной настройке.

Соединение между сервером, хранилищем данных и пользовательским оболочкой

Клиентский интерфейс составляет внешнюю часть приложения. Элементы и элементы посылают инструкции на серверную часть. Сервер является связующим между пользователем и базой информации. Он обрабатывает обращения и генерирует команды к сведениям.

1вин казино извлекает требуемую сведения из таблиц. Сервер конвертирует результаты в формат для пользовательского программы. Информация поступают в интерфейс для отображения. Трёхслойная структура распределяет обязанности между элементами. Такое разделение упрощает создание и обслуживание решения. Каждый слой изменяется самостоятельно от других частей.

Почему данные необходимо не лишь сохранять, а корректно упорядочивать

Беспорядочное размещение данных влечёт к замедленной работе системы. Выборка требуемой записи среди миллионов объектов отнимает большое период. Корректная организация повышает доступ и уменьшает загрузку на технику.

Нормализация устраняет повторение и экономит физическое пространство. Связи между таблицами обеспечивают целостность сведений. 1вин казино поддерживает согласованность данных при одновременных изменениях. Индексирование ключевых столбцов генерирует быстрые пути входа. Грамотная структура хранилища повышает стабильность и производительность всего программы.

Реляционные и нереляционные базы данных: в чем разница на применении

Реляционные решения структурируют сведения в таблицы со строгой организацией. Связи между таблицами обеспечивают целостность информации. Язык SQL позволяет осуществлять сложные команды и комбинировать данные из различных хранилищ.

Нереляционные системы используют адаптивные схемы организации. Документоориентированные решения записывают информацию в JSON-структурах. Графовые системы настроены для работы со связями между элементами.

1вин подбирается в соответствии от требований проекта. Реляционные применимы для транзакционных систем с четкой структурой. Нереляционные предоставляют масштабируемость и пластичность схемы информации.

Как обращения помогают доставать нужную информацию из репозитория

Команды составляют собой директивы для извлечения или изменения сведений. Язык SQL даёт формулировать критерии выборки и отбора записей. Система выбирает наилучший метод исполнения команды.

Главные категории действий с информацией:

  • Извлечение данных по определённым условиям
  • Внесение дополнительных данных в таблицы
  • Изменение имеющихся данных
  • Удаление старой сведений

1win casino оптимизирует выполнение запросов с помощью индексов. Сложные команды объединяют информацию из множества таблиц. Сводные функции определяют суммы и усреднённые величины. Корректно составленные запросы ускоряют извлечение данных.

Значение API в передаче сведениями между приложениями

API является системный протокол для связи между платформами. Механизм задаёт правила передачи информацией и форматы отправки сведений. Приложения используют API для доступа опций внешних сервисов.

REST API действует через HTTP-протокол и использует типовые методы команд. Пользователь посылает команду с данными. Машина выполняет обращение и отдаёт ответ в виде JSON. 1вин казино выдаёт информацию через API для внешних сервисов.

Протоколы обеспечивают интегрировать платежные сервисы, карты и социальные платформы. Программисты создают модульные программы с взаимодействием через API. Такой способ упрощает рост платформы.

Почему быстродействие сервера сказывается на функционирование всего сервиса

Время реакции сервера устанавливает темп отображения веб-страниц и исполнения команд. Низкая обслуживание запросов понижает конверсию. Каждая избыточная секунда задержки увеличивает процент уходов.

Производительность оборудования влияет на число синхронно выполняемых обращений. Слабая сила процессора формирует очереди и задержки. Оперативная ОЗУ ограничивает объем буферизуемых данных.

Доработка алгоритмов улучшает производительность работы. Производительный сервер гарантирует приятное использование с программой. Скорость системы воздействует на лояльность юзеров и успешность сервиса.

Как серверы обслуживают с огромным количеством пользователей

Рост пользователей порождает повышенную нагрузку на инфраструктуру. Единственный сервер не способен обслуживать миллионы команд синхронно. Архитектуры задействуют множественные методы для балансировки загрузки.

Горизонтальное масштабирование включает дополнительные машины. Балансировщик делит приходящие команды между серверами. Каждый сервер выполняет часть трафика. Вертикальное масштабирование повышает производительность аппаратуры.

Кластеры функционируют как целостная система и обеспечивают стабильность. При сбое единственной сервера прочие продолжают обрабатывать клиентов. Корректная структура обеспечивает обрабатывать увеличивающийся трафик без ухудшения качества.

Масштабирование трафика

Разделение запросов между несколькими серверами 1вин казино исключает переполнение платформы. Балансировщик оценивает актуальную занятость серверов и перенаправляет поток на менее занятые узлы. Автоматизированное добавление узлов случается при повышении объёма пользователей. Архитектура адаптируется в соответствии от реальной нужды в технических мощностях.

Кэширование и распределение запросов

Кэш записывает регулярно востребованные информацию в быстрой ОЗУ. Вторичные запросы к сведениям не требуют запросов к хранилищу. Распределённый буфер находится на нескольких машинах для роста ёмкости. CDN передаёт фиксированный содержимое из близких к клиенту серверов. Такие инструменты уменьшают трафик на основную архитектуру и ускоряют реакцию системы.

Сохранность сведений: оборона, запасные бэкапы и надзор входа

Охрана сведений требует интегрированного подхода на всех уровнях платформы. Кодирование информации блокирует несанкционированный вход при перехвате данных. Протоколы охраны 1вин обеспечивают конфиденциальность передачи информации.

Механизм надзора допуска лимитирует права клиентов в зависимости от статуса. Аутентификация удостоверяет легитимность учетных профилей. Систематическое создание запасных копий охраняет от пропажи информации при отказах.

Дубликаты размещаются на независимых серверах или в облачных репозиториях. Автоматизированное дублирование производится по расписанию. Операции возврата обеспечивают моментально возобновить дееспособность платформы.

Что случается при сбоях и как системы восстанавливаются

Технические отказы случаются по разным факторам: поломка аппаратуры, ошибки программ, избыточность канала. Системы контроля проверяют статус модулей и сигнализируют о проблемах. Автоматизированные механизмы инициируют операции восстановления.

Основные фазы возврата функциональности:

  • Обнаружение сбоя через мониторинг
  • Перенаправление нагрузки на дублирующие серверы
  • Реанимация сведений из дубликатов
  • Устранение поломки

Копирование информации на ряд машин обеспечивает непрерывность деятельности. При сбое единственного узла платформа применяет дублирующие бэкапы. Период возврата определяется от организации инфраструктуры.

Почему базы данных и серверы продолжают основой виртуального пространства

Всякий нынешний цифровой продукт нуждается устойчивого хранения и выполнения информации. Машины 1win casino производят операции и координируют работу приложений. Базы сведений обеспечивают скоростной доступ к данным. Эволюция методов не отменяет фундаментальные принципы организации. Осознание функционирования системы способствует создавать производительные и гибкие системы.

Author
Brooklyn Simmons

Binterdum posuere lorem ipsum dolor. Adipiscing vitae proin sagittis nisl rhoncus mattis rhoncus. Lectus vestibulum mattis ullamcorper velit sed. Facilisis volutpat est

Leave a Reply

Related Post